I have a HUD problem... sorry about the title..

I was trying to adjust my HUD to go a little higher on the windshield and when i did....it went to opposite way..pushing up made it go down and down made it go up..

but once it got fully to the bottom it got stuck and i can't see it at all unless i put my head next to the roof and look at it!!

Any ideas on how to fix or what happened? Do i just need to go to a dealer?

I would try to pull the battery negative cable (or the correct fuse) for a couple of minutes.

This might just reset the thing.

Remember to re-index the windows.

To sum up what the service manual says, you test to see if the switchs are working correctly and depending of the outcome of the test, replace either the switch pod or the HUD unit.

Your best bet would be to let your service department check it out.
